Hebrew (Modern) Honours A

HBRW4021

The Honours program in Modern Hebrew consists of:1. a thesis written under the supervision of one or more members of academic staff2. two seminars in semester 1 and one seminar in semester 2, meeting weekly for 2 hours eachThe thesis should be of 12000 words in length if written in Hebrew or 15000 words in length if written in English. Each seminar requires 5000 words of written work or its equivalent. The thesis is worth 40% of the final Honours mark and each of the seminars is worth 20%.Seminars will be offered from the following list in 2013:'Language in use' as reflected in MH Discourse; Research MethodologiesFor more information, contact Yona Gilead, Honours coordinator.
